NEW LEGO STORE COMING TO FREEHOLD RACEWAY MALL IN CENTRAL NJ!!!

Featured Replies

Finally, a LEGO store being built in central NJ in the Freehold Raceway Mall. For a state that is one of the wealthiest in the nation(...and it's not because of Jeff and I...LOL), the lack of LEGO stores always amazed me. Well, on June 21, 22, and 23, 2013, the new LEGO store will be running a Grand Opening. I received a card to hand in for a special LEGO Hulk brick. Hopefully, there will be other specials. From a personal standpoint, it is nice to have a LEGO store within a half hours drive. I always missed out on any sort of deals.
